- New research shows pupil-teacher ratios in Region 6 of The Gambia hit 44:1 – double the urban levels. Remote schools face the biggest shortages. This report reveals more and offers solutions to improve deployment and support learning. Read more: www.unicef.org/innocenti/re...

- @unicef.org's Report Card 19 finds that children are less happy with their lives, are more likely to be overweight and are not doing as well in school. Progress in child well-being is increasingly vulnerable to global events and shocks. Find out more: www.unicef.org/innocenti/re...
- Growing up in a wealthy country does not guarantee a happy and healthy childhood. Some of the richest countries have seen significant declines in academic performance, mental health & physical health. Read @UNICEF's latest Report Card & find out more: www.unicef.org/innocenti/re...

- Around 240 million children worldwide have some form of disability. Critical gaps in evidence remain and that leaves policymakers and others without the data they need to help. UNICEF Innocenti is committed to filling those gaps through our research. Find out more: www.unicef.org/innocenti/pr...
